What Happens When Workers’ Comp Falls Short in Roseland

While workers’ compensation covers many injuries, it often fails to provide complete recovery, especially if your injury leads to chronic health problems or affects your ability to return to your previous job. What many people don’t realize is that they may also have the option to file a third-party personal injury claim in addition to their workers’ comp benefits.

A third-party claim can be pursued if your injury was caused by someone other than your employer, such as:

A subcontractor or vendor on a shared worksite
A negligent property owner or general contractor
A manufacturer of faulty equipment or tools
A careless driver who caused an accident while you were on the job

Construction Site Injuries in Roseland

Construction zones are some of the most dangerous workplaces in Roseland. With powerful tools, toxic chemicals, and work done at great heights, the risk of serious injury is ever-present. In fact, the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) reports that a fifth of worker deaths are reported in the construction industry. The leading causes — known as the “Fatal Four” — are falls, being struck by objects, exposure to electrical hazards, and being crushed or trapped.
These injuries often involve multiple parties — including site managers, property owners, and third-party contractors — and require a seasoned legal team to sort through the liability.

The Power of Clinical Records in Proving Your Claim

Strong clinical evidence is the cornerstone of any successful job-related injury case. Comprehensive notes not only prove the extent of your injuries but also establish a clear link between the on-the-job accident and your health status. Essential medical documents include:
Initial Medical Reports

Immediate assessments post-injury.

Diagnostic Test Results

X-rays, MRIs, and other relevant tests.

Treatment Records

Documentation of ongoing treatments and therapies.

Physician Statements

Professional opinions on your injury's impact on your work capabilities.

Ensuring that all medical evidence is comprehensive and accurately reflects your condition can significantly bolster your claim.
